Preparation and monitoring device suitable for multi-size fracture toughness sample prefabricated crack Technical Field The utility model relates to the technical field of fracture toughness monitoring, in particular to a preparation and monitoring device suitable for multi-size fracture toughness sample prefabricated cracks. Background Fracture toughness is one of the important mechanical properties of metals, which reflects the resistance of a metallic material to crack propagation. The prefabricated fatigue crack is a very important step in fracture toughness test, however, in practical operation, the length of the prefabricated fatigue crack is difficult to observe, a method for calculating the length of the fatigue crack by using the opening amount of a COD gauge is specified in ASTM E399, however, the COD gauge is extremely fragile under long-time high-frequency fatigue load, and in the test process of some small-size samples, the COD gauge is difficult to match with the samples, so that a more proper method is needed for monitoring the generation and the expansion of the crack. In addition, in different product standards, fracture toughness samples are different in size and correspond to a plurality of different tools, so that the test efficiency is reduced while the test space is occupied. Therefore, there is a need to provide a new device for preparing and monitoring the prefabricated cracks of the multi-size fracture toughness test sample, which solves the above technical problems. Disclosure of utility model The utility model solves the technical problem of providing a preparation and monitoring device which is suitable for fracture toughness test tools with various sizes, monitors crack length by a method of monitoring strain, reduces high-frequency use of COD gauges and is suitable for prefabrication cracks of fracture toughness samples with various sizes. In order to solve the technical problems, the preparation and monitoring device suitable for the multi-size fracture toughness sample prefabrication cracks comprises two symmetrically arranged clamps 1, wherein two supporting rollers 2 are symmetrically arranged on the clamps 1, one loading pin 3 is arranged between the same supporting rollers 2, two ends of the loading pin 3 extend into the supporting rollers 2 respectively, one sample 6 to be tested is arranged on the two loading pins 3, and a stress sheet 5 is arranged on one side of the sample 6 to be tested. Preferably, a dynamic strain gauge 7 is further included, and the dynamic strain gauge 7 is connected with the stress sheet 5. Preferably, positioning gaskets 4 are arranged on two sides of the clamp 1, and the positioning gaskets 4 are in contact with the supporting roller 2. Preferably, screws are arranged on both sides of the clamp 1, and penetrate through the corresponding positioning gaskets 4. Preferably, a plurality of mounting grooves are formed in one side of the support roller 2, and the apertures of the plurality of mounting grooves are different. Compared with the related art, the preparation and monitoring device suitable for the multi-size fracture toughness sample pre-cracking has the following beneficial effects: The utility model provides a preparation and monitoring device suitable for multi-size fracture toughness sample prefabricated cracks, which can be used for improving the applicability of the whole device by arranging loading pins 3 with different diameters according to different samples 6 to be tested through a supporting roller 2, limiting the supporting roller 2 through the arrangement of a positioning gasket 4 so as to ensure that the supporting roller 2 cannot slide down in the test process, and monitoring a strain curve of the bottom center of the sample through a strain gauge 5 and a dynamic strain gauge 7.
